Mac下添加多个git ssh key

1、生成自定义名称ssh

1、cd到~/.ssh目录下
2、生成指令: ssh-keygen -t rsa -C "xx@xx.com"
3、以上命令后,会让你输入ssh key的保存文件名
4、接下来输入密码,可以直接回车过

截屏2021-01-28 下午3.39.03.png

2、去git添加ssh key

1、使用指令获取值:cat id_rsa_pri.pub
2、在~/.ssh目录下,使用文本编辑器打开 id_rsa_pri.pub

3、把私钥添加到git

指令: ssh-add -K id_rsa_pri

4、配置文件

1、创建:touch config
2、配置:vim config
默认创建
Host xx.com
HostName xx.com
User xx@xx.com
IdentityFile ~/.ssh/id_rsa

自定义创建
Host github.com
HostName github.com
User xx@xx.com
IdentityFile ~/.ssh/id_rsa_pri

5、克隆代码

使用git clone xx.com:xx 代码时,会提示。选择yes后,加入known_hosts中。

6、最终目录

截屏2021-01-28 下午3.52.34.png
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容